  3. VHB937

VHB937 is a potent and selective TREM2 agonist, a human monoclonal antibody, with sub-nanomolar affinity. VHB937 enhances TREM2 surface expression and downstream signaling, such as Syk phosphorylation and calcium mobilization. VHB937 exhibits robust neuroprotective effects in vivo, significantly reducing pathology and pro-inflammatory markers across a broad range of animal models of neuroinflammation and neurodegeneration. VHB937 can be used for neurodegenerative diseases research.

In Vitro

VHB937 increases Syk-phosphorylation and drives calcium signaling in human primary cells with endogenous TREM2 expression[1].
VHB937 facilitates key functions of microglia cells like chemotaxis and phagocytosis[1].

In Vivo

VHB937 promotes neuronal health and ameliorates astrogliosis in diverse neurodegenerative disease animal models, through the induction of a neuroprotective microglial phenotype, demonstrating its efficacy beyond microglia[1].
